I have a Sena 20s EVO and I noticed that the seal on the clamp where the head unit connects is falling apart. This causes connection issues when riding in the rain. I cannot find a replacement seal. Has anybody repaired this? Please let me know how. I am looking for ideas.
 
I don't own a com device (yet). Have you called Sena customer service?

Fortnine chided Sena for making a unit that was not completely waterproof when it is designed to be worn on the outside of a helmet (in the rain). Next time look at Cardo.
 
A liberal dose of dielectric grease may help.

I use the shield seal lube that came with my Shoei, to keep the seal sorry and pliable. I use the same seal lube around the seal on my Garmin Navigator 5 ,which has a similar seal where it mates up with the gps cradle contacts. Good results so far.

Dielectric grease as Pat suggests is a good solution as well.
 
The same foam seal on my 30k has torn along the outside edge, rendering it no longer water resistant...
I just sent Sena an email and will see what happens. In lieu of getting a replacement, I will likely cut one from a similar thickness and durometer of foam (If can find some)
